Server Logs on Ubuntu & Introduction to Central Logging
GNU/Linux sysadmins need to look at the log files for various purposes. Logs are usually located at /var/log. You can run ls -l /var/log on your server to realize the big size of list on a production server. It is not practical to run UNIX command to check the logs when the number of servers are not exactly few.
